I've just finished reading [[Elizabeth: A Diamond Jubilee Portrait by Jennie Bond]] and you might be wondering which book to go for. If you're a dedicated royal watcher who's seen most of the pictures of the Queen and her family then you'll find something new in the Ewart book. On the other hand, if you're looking for a very good overview of the first sixty years of the Queen's reign then you might prefer the Jennie Bond book which is much heavier on content.
